Tomb Raider, The Cradle of Life

Director: Jan De Bont
Cast: Angelina Jolie, Chris Barrie, Gerard Butler, Ciaram Hinds, Djimon Hounsow.

The first version had the curvaceous Lara Croft racing against time and succeeding in getting her hands on a powerful relic that had power over life and death. This time Croft is back to retrieve the mythological 'Pandora's Box' which if in the wrong hands could be used as a powerful weapon to unleash terror in the world.

But Croft is not alone in her search. There is also the evil and ambitious Dr. Reiss (Hinds) who wants to get his hands on the box and hold the world to ransom. There is Chen Lo, the kingpin of the Chinese crime syndicate who has ganged up with Reiss and has upstaged Croft in edging closer to the box. Finally, there is Terry (Butler) Croft's old beau, who'd turned mercenary and was convicted for treason. Croft gets Terry out of prison, with the promise of a new life, and the duo embark on their mission.

Based on a popular video game, the film has been shot in exotic locales in the lush forests of Kenya and Tanzania, in China, Hongkong, and in England and Wales. There are lines addressed to Croft like, "Do you ever do things the easy way?". And Croft's final reckoning when she says, "Some things are never meant to be found!". With a lot of action and special effects, the film has 116 minutes of running time, and it is fascinating to watch Angelina Jolie in all her style and action.
